Thermo Scientific Nicolet iS50 FTIR Spectrometer

The Nicolet iS50 is an electrical Fourier Transform Infrared (FTIR) spectrometer that uses infrared radiation for chemical analysis by identifying molecular structures through absorption spectra. It falls under HTS 9027.50.40.15 as an optical radiation-based instrument specifically for chemical analysis, featuring electrical components for data processing and display. Commonly used in labs for material identification and quality control.

Alternative Classifications

This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.

9027.30Lower: 10% vs 35%

If primarily for viscosity or surface tension measurement

Instruments measuring physical properties like viscosity fall under a separate subheading, not chemical analysis.

8471.80.90Higher: 50% vs 35%

If classified as general automatic data processing equipment

Standalone computers without dedicated optical chemical analysis hardware go to Chapter 84.

9031.80.80Same rate: 35%

If for non-optical measuring/checking instruments

Optical radiation-specific chemical analyzers stay in 9027; purely electrical or mechanical go to 9031.
